Constantia
The Cape's historic cradle
- Soil
- Decomposed granite on cool, breezy slopes of the Cape Peninsula, near False Bay.
- Style
- World-historic sweet Muscat ('Vin de Constance') plus crisp, cool Sauvignon Blanc.
- Top sites
- South Africa's oldest wine ward, founded 1685; in Cape Town's suburbs.
- Vintages
- Vin de Constance: 2015, 2017, 2019; SB: 2021–23
- Producers
- Groot ConstantiaConstantia Glen
Tip · Constantia is the birthplace of Cape wine (1685). Its sweet 'Vin de Constance' was adored by European courts and even requested by Napoleon in exile.
